1. Wood-look tiles will be endlessly popular

The best-selling tile category, wood-look tiles are very strong and genuine looking. In terms of styles and designs, they suit both the country style and the more elegant contemporary scene. Install them in traditional kitchens and urban attics.
Try a sample of the 6 x 36 Deep Walnut Country Tile. The year 2017 brings many new sizes and shapes of wood-look tiles. The narrow and short boards that existed in the middle of the century are back. A slim 4×28 is planned, ideal for herringbone patterns. Larger 60-inch planks are also popular. Brick, hexagons and mosaics are popular in wood design in 2017.

The new and the traditional reign equally in hearts in 2017. Look out for Scandinavian and larch wood, as well as the look of oak. Graphics printing has created chipped edges and saw marks, hand-scraped prints, and vibration marks.
Finishes from centuries past are becoming common, such as brushed wire with a deeper grain and texture and the whitewashed ceruse look. Technology facilitates stunning replicas of wood surfaces like Oak Trail XT 6 x 36 Field Tile.

2. A unified indoor and outdoor experience

The transition from inner to outer life is blurring. Tile selections are equally well suited to both purposes. Saddle Brook XT is suitable for outdoors, as is Slate Attaché. They are strong and easy to clean. Choose the 2cm pavers that are twice as thick as regular tile. Stone-look mosaic tiles in an amazing variety draw a lot of attention. Many versions of wood, stone, and cement-look tile will be used in the kitchen and on the patio. Lay them on gravel or sand, even on dirty surfaces.

4. The Metal/Textile effect

Metal and textile look tiles will be widespread in 2017. Gunmetal and pewter in matte or light polished finishes. Linen and tweed patterns as well as stone and cement! Chenille White Limestone is great.

5 stone

White marble like white Carrara marble and many colored marbles too like gray and beige, black and brown will hit the scene in 2017. Bluestone will also make it big. Stone and ceramic tiles are everywhere.

6. Amazing wall tiles

Bright colors and 3D/geometric shapes along with large format porcelain tiles ranging from 8×24 to 24×48 will be all the rage in 2017.
